The 4 sentences that changed my motherhood 👇👇

But before I start - I WISH I’d known these earlier, I wish we prepared mothers with this knowledge, I wish every single mother could know what I have learned.

1️⃣ Motherhood is meant to change you

🌙 you don’t “go back” to your old self, and trying to will break you
🌙 you don’t “bounce back” into your old body, social life, relationships , values
🌙 you grow forwards in a new version of you - with different values, perspectives and priorities
🌙 this process of growing forwards is called matrescence
🌙 this process is like putting a jigsaw puzzle back together, it takes years, you’ll put the wrong pieces in the wrong places - thats ok

2️⃣ Get on your own side

🌙 your inner critic will become very loud in motherhood, because it gets louder the more you care about something
🌙 we have to learn to become our own inner support system - we can get through anything when we’re our own supporter
🌙 learn to challenge the voice telling you you’re not good enough, you can’t cope and you don’t deserve your children

3️⃣ “Mum” guilt is a trick to keep us small

🌙 you need good guilt, it keeps us on track with our values, helps us to say sorry and reflect on our behaviour
🌙 but that isn’t what “mum” guilt is
🌙 mum guilt is when we think we’re wrong but we’re not. Because it’s not wrong to work, or to meet our own needs or to be imperfect. It’s human.
🌙 learn to challenge your guilt using my 80/20 rule so you can free yourself from it and finally feel good enough

4️⃣ We can’t be the mothers we want to be if we’re depleted

🌙meeting your own needs too is the least selfish thing you can do as a mother
🌙 we can only give when we have capacity to give from, or we burn out - and that hurts everyone
🌙 we already know how to care and meet needs - we do it all day for our children, we just have to include ourselves in our care
🌙 learning to regulate your stress response is the best gift you can give yourself and your children

6 other types of rest (that have nothing to do with sleep) 👇

😴 Sleep deprivation is serious. That’s why it’s used as a form of torture, it impacts you on every level.

But when you’re a parent- the usual advice on sleep can be so frustrating because how much sleep you get isn’t usually in your control.

I wish I’d known earlier, that there are 6 other types of rest that have nothing to do with sleep. Here they are, AND I’ve given a 3 minute idea under each one….

1. Mental Rest: giving your thinking mind a break
- listen to a short guided meditation I use @calm every day

2. Sensory Rest : to counter the overstimulation
- get in the bathroom - turn off all the light and take 3 deep breaths

3. Creative Rest - taking a break from the analysing and responsibilities
- walk outside with your shoes off (grounding)

4. Emotional Rest - suppressing your true emotions takes energy
- Give yourself a few minutes to get curious about how you really feel permission without judgment.

5. Social Rest - recharging your social battery
- jot down 3 people you feel safe with, and 3 people who drain your energy
- Cancel social plans if you need to

6. Spiritual Rest: feeling a deeper sense of purpose and connection
- do 3 minutes of practices that help you feel connected to a higher purpose or your inner self, such as prayer, meditation, or spending time in nature.
